Probleme php :(
                    
        
     
             
                    layork
    
        
    
                    Messages postés
            
                
     
             
            364
        
            
                                    Statut
            Membre
                    
                -
                                     
layork Messages postés 364 Statut Membre -
        layork Messages postés 364 Statut Membre -
        salu a tous!!!
bon, j'explique mon probleme:
en fait je fais un formulaire, et je recupere les données par la methode post, mais le probleme, c'est qe dans la page ou je recupere, je ne recupere que le premier champs, et pas les autre
voila la page formulaire:
<html>
<head>
<title>Nouvel appel</title>
</head>
<body bgcolor=#33ccff>
<img border="0" src="caliseo.jpg">
<h2>Nouvel appel</h2>
<form name=creation ACTION="traitementnouvelappel.php" METHOD="POST">
<table border="3" cellspacing="0" cellpadding="5">
<tr>
<td>Nom diplomat:</td>
<td><input type="texte" name="nom_diplomat" size="20"></td>
</tr>
<tr>
<td>Nom contact:</td>
<td><input type="texte" name="nom_contact" size="20"></td>
</tr>
     
<tr>
<td>Date:<br>jj/mm/aaaa</td>
<td><input type="texte" size="20" name="date" size="20"></td>
</tr>
    
<tr>
<td>Duree:</td>
<td><input type="texte" size="5" name="duree" size="20"></td>
</tr>
    
<tr>
<td>Probleme:</td>
<td><textarea rows="5" name="probleme" cols="30"></textarea></td>
</tr>
   
<tr>
<td>Resolution:</td>
<td><textarea rows="5" name="resolution" cols="30"></textarea></td>
</tr>
   
<tr>
<td>Societe:</td>
<td><select size="1" name="societe">
<option>Caliseo</option>
<option>Tracing server</option>
</select></td>
   	  
</tr>
     
</table>
<input type="submit" value="Ajouter">
<br><a href=acceuilhotline.htm>Retour a la page d acceuil</a>
</body>
</html>
et la page de traitement:
<html>
<head>
<title>Traitement nouvel appel</title>
</head>
<body bgcolor=#33ccff>
<img border="0" src="caliseo.jpg">
<h1> <div align="center">Votre nouvel appel a ete enregistrer</div></h1>
<?
$bdd = "hotline";
$user = "root";
$passwd = "";
$host = "localhost";
mysql_connect($host, $user,$passwd) or die("erreur de connexion au serveur");
mysql_select_db($bdd) or die("erreur de connexion a la base de donnees");
$nom_diplomat=$_POST['nom_diplomat'];
$nom_contact=$_POST['nom_contact'];
$date=$_POST['date'];
$duree=$_POST['duree'];
$probleme=$_POST['probleme'];
$resolution=$_POST['resolution'];
$societe=$_POST['societe'];
  
/* $requette="INSERT INTO appels ( nom_diplomat , nom_contact , date , duree , probleme , resolution , societe )
VALUES ($nom_diplomat , $nom_contact , $date , $duree , $duree , $probleme , $resolution )";
$requettenouvelappel=mysql_query($requette);
echo($requette);*/
echo($nom_diplomat);
echo($nom_contact);
echo($date);
echo($duree);
echo($probleme);
echo($resolution);
?>
</body>
</html>
j'espere que vous pourrez me venir en aide, merci d'avance ;)
l'informatique ca rend fou!!!!!
                
            
                
    
    
    
        bon, j'explique mon probleme:
en fait je fais un formulaire, et je recupere les données par la methode post, mais le probleme, c'est qe dans la page ou je recupere, je ne recupere que le premier champs, et pas les autre
voila la page formulaire:
<html>
<head>
<title>Nouvel appel</title>
</head>
<body bgcolor=#33ccff>
<img border="0" src="caliseo.jpg">
<h2>Nouvel appel</h2>
<form name=creation ACTION="traitementnouvelappel.php" METHOD="POST">
<table border="3" cellspacing="0" cellpadding="5">
<tr>
<td>Nom diplomat:</td>
<td><input type="texte" name="nom_diplomat" size="20"></td>
</tr>
<tr>
<td>Nom contact:</td>
<td><input type="texte" name="nom_contact" size="20"></td>
</tr>
<tr>
<td>Date:<br>jj/mm/aaaa</td>
<td><input type="texte" size="20" name="date" size="20"></td>
</tr>
<tr>
<td>Duree:</td>
<td><input type="texte" size="5" name="duree" size="20"></td>
</tr>
<tr>
<td>Probleme:</td>
<td><textarea rows="5" name="probleme" cols="30"></textarea></td>
</tr>
<tr>
<td>Resolution:</td>
<td><textarea rows="5" name="resolution" cols="30"></textarea></td>
</tr>
<tr>
<td>Societe:</td>
<td><select size="1" name="societe">
<option>Caliseo</option>
<option>Tracing server</option>
</select></td>
</tr>
</table>
<input type="submit" value="Ajouter">
<br><a href=acceuilhotline.htm>Retour a la page d acceuil</a>
</body>
</html>
et la page de traitement:
<html>
<head>
<title>Traitement nouvel appel</title>
</head>
<body bgcolor=#33ccff>
<img border="0" src="caliseo.jpg">
<h1> <div align="center">Votre nouvel appel a ete enregistrer</div></h1>
<?
$bdd = "hotline";
$user = "root";
$passwd = "";
$host = "localhost";
mysql_connect($host, $user,$passwd) or die("erreur de connexion au serveur");
mysql_select_db($bdd) or die("erreur de connexion a la base de donnees");
$nom_diplomat=$_POST['nom_diplomat'];
$nom_contact=$_POST['nom_contact'];
$date=$_POST['date'];
$duree=$_POST['duree'];
$probleme=$_POST['probleme'];
$resolution=$_POST['resolution'];
$societe=$_POST['societe'];
/* $requette="INSERT INTO appels ( nom_diplomat , nom_contact , date , duree , probleme , resolution , societe )
VALUES ($nom_diplomat , $nom_contact , $date , $duree , $duree , $probleme , $resolution )";
$requettenouvelappel=mysql_query($requette);
echo($requette);*/
echo($nom_diplomat);
echo($nom_contact);
echo($date);
echo($duree);
echo($probleme);
echo($resolution);
?>
</body>
</html>
j'espere que vous pourrez me venir en aide, merci d'avance ;)
l'informatique ca rend fou!!!!!
        A voir également:         
- Probleme php :(
- Easy php - Télécharger - Divers Web & Internet
- Expert php pinterest - Télécharger - Langages
- Retour à la ligne php ✓ - Forum PHP
- Alert php - Forum PHP
- Retour a la ligne php ✓ - Forum PHP
15 réponses
                        
                    Il te manque le </form> dans ta page de formulaire.
Kalamit,
11 jours avant le soleil, la mer et les mouettes. :)
    
                Kalamit,
11 jours avant le soleil, la mer et les mouettes. :)
                        
                    Slt,
j'ai regardé vite fait et j'ai l'impression que tu n'a pas fermer la balise </form> après ton bouton ajouter.
Dis moi si çà vien de la, je continu a chercher
    
                j'ai regardé vite fait et j'ai l'impression que tu n'a pas fermer la balise </form> après ton bouton ajouter.
Dis moi si çà vien de la, je continu a chercher
                        
                    Salut Layork !
On t'avais pas vu aujourd'hui ! lol
Euh j'ai remarqué que tu n'avais pas fermé ta balise <form> dans ta premiere page, ferme la et reessai pour voir.
Flipody
    
                On t'avais pas vu aujourd'hui ! lol
Euh j'ai remarqué que tu n'avais pas fermé ta balise <form> dans ta premiere page, ferme la et reessai pour voir.
Flipody
Vous n’avez pas trouvé la réponse que vous recherchez ?
Posez votre question
                        
                    c est exact, merci, mais cela ne resoud pas le probleme, il y a toujours que le premier echo qui fonctionne :(
l'informatique ca rend fou!!!!!
    
                l'informatique ca rend fou!!!!!
                        
                    Pourtant avec autant de BONS en informatique qui répondent en même temps, çà aurait du être çà.
Bon j'arrête de me faire des compliments tout seul (surtout que perso je suis pas si bon que çà)
    
                Bon j'arrête de me faire des compliments tout seul (surtout que perso je suis pas si bon que çà)
                        
                    ba j aurais aimer que ce soit ca, mais non....
si des autre BONS peuve m'aider, n'esitez pas :p
et meme si les bons qui ont deja planchés sur le probleme voient autre chose, je suis preneur ;)
l'informatique ca rend fou!!!!!
    
                si des autre BONS peuve m'aider, n'esitez pas :p
et meme si les bons qui ont deja planchés sur le probleme voient autre chose, je suis preneur ;)
l'informatique ca rend fou!!!!!
                        
                    pour info, voila la nouvelle fin de mon tableau:
<tr>
<td>Societe:</td>
<td><select size="1" name="societe">
<option>Caliseo</option>
<option>Tracing server</option>
</select></td>
   	  
</tr>
     
</table>
<input type="submit" value="Ajouter">
</form>
l'informatique ca rend fou!!!!!
    
                <tr>
<td>Societe:</td>
<td><select size="1" name="societe">
<option>Caliseo</option>
<option>Tracing server</option>
</select></td>
</tr>
</table>
<input type="submit" value="Ajouter">
</form>
l'informatique ca rend fou!!!!!
                        
                    Bon, deja le type d'un input c'est "text et non pas "texte".
Kalamit,
11 jours avant le soleil, la mer et les mouettes. :)
    
                Kalamit,
11 jours avant le soleil, la mer et les mouettes. :)
                        
                    lol, oui c es vrai!!!
tu vois maintenant a cause de toi je parle plus que le francais :p lol
j ai modifier, mais rien n'y fait!!! marche toujours pas :(
l'informatique ca rend fou!!!!!
    
                tu vois maintenant a cause de toi je parle plus que le francais :p lol
j ai modifier, mais rien n'y fait!!! marche toujours pas :(
l'informatique ca rend fou!!!!!
                        
                    bon, je vous remet les 2 pages "corrigées" qui marche pas :p
<html>
<head>
<title>Nouvel appel</title>
</head>
<body bgcolor=#33ccff>
<img border="0" src="caliseo.jpg">
<h2>Nouvel appel</h2>
<form name=creation ACTION="traitementnouvelappel.php" METHOD="POST">
<table border="3" cellspacing="0" cellpadding="5">
<tr>
<td>Nom diplomat:</td>
<td><input type="text" name="nom_diplomat" size="20"></td>
</tr>
<tr>
<td>Nom contact:</td>
<td><input type="text" name="nom_contact" size="20"></td>
</tr>
     
<tr>
<td>Date:<br>jj/mm/aaaa</td>
<td><input type="text" size="20" name="date" size="20"></td>
</tr>
    
<tr>
<td>Duree:</td>
<td><input type="text" size="5" name="duree" size="20"></td>
</tr>
    
<tr>
<td>Probleme:</td>
<td><textarea rows="5" name="probleme" cols="30"></textarea></td>
</tr>
   
<tr>
<td>Resolution:</td>
<td><textarea rows="5" name="resolution" cols="30"></textarea></td>
</tr>
   
<tr>
<td>Societe:</td>
<td><select size="1" name="societe">
<option>Caliseo</option>
<option>Tracing server</option>
</select></td>
   	  
</tr>
     
</table>
<input type="submit" value="Ajouter">
</form>
<br><a href=acceuilhotline.htm>Retour a la page d acceuil</a>
</body>
</html>
<html>
<head>
<title>Traitement nouvel appel</title>
</head>
<body bgcolor=#33ccff>
<img border="0" src="caliseo.jpg">
<h1> <div align="center">Votre nouvel appel a ete enregistrer</div></h1>
<?
$bdd = "hotline";
$user = "root";
$passwd = "";
$host = "localhost";
mysql_connect($host, $user,$passwd) or die("erreur de connexion au serveur");
mysql_select_db($bdd) or die("erreur de connexion a la base de donnees");
$nom_diplomat=$_POST['nom_diplomat'];
$nom_contact=$_POST['nom_contact'];
$date=$_POST['date'];
$duree=$_POST['duree'];
$probleme=$_POST['probleme'];
$resolution=$_POST['resolution'];
$societe=$_POST['societe'];
  
/* $requette="INSERT INTO appels ( nom_diplomat , nom_contact , date , duree , probleme , resolution , societe )
VALUES ($nom_diplomat , $nom_contact , $date , $duree , $duree , $probleme , $resolution )";
$requettenouvelappel=mysql_query($requette);
echo($requette);*/
echo($nom_diplomat);
echo($nom_contact);
echo($date);
echo($duree);
echo($probleme);
echo($resolution);
?>
</body>
</html>
l'informatique ca rend fou!!!!!
    
                <html>
<head>
<title>Nouvel appel</title>
</head>
<body bgcolor=#33ccff>
<img border="0" src="caliseo.jpg">
<h2>Nouvel appel</h2>
<form name=creation ACTION="traitementnouvelappel.php" METHOD="POST">
<table border="3" cellspacing="0" cellpadding="5">
<tr>
<td>Nom diplomat:</td>
<td><input type="text" name="nom_diplomat" size="20"></td>
</tr>
<tr>
<td>Nom contact:</td>
<td><input type="text" name="nom_contact" size="20"></td>
</tr>
<tr>
<td>Date:<br>jj/mm/aaaa</td>
<td><input type="text" size="20" name="date" size="20"></td>
</tr>
<tr>
<td>Duree:</td>
<td><input type="text" size="5" name="duree" size="20"></td>
</tr>
<tr>
<td>Probleme:</td>
<td><textarea rows="5" name="probleme" cols="30"></textarea></td>
</tr>
<tr>
<td>Resolution:</td>
<td><textarea rows="5" name="resolution" cols="30"></textarea></td>
</tr>
<tr>
<td>Societe:</td>
<td><select size="1" name="societe">
<option>Caliseo</option>
<option>Tracing server</option>
</select></td>
</tr>
</table>
<input type="submit" value="Ajouter">
</form>
<br><a href=acceuilhotline.htm>Retour a la page d acceuil</a>
</body>
</html>
<html>
<head>
<title>Traitement nouvel appel</title>
</head>
<body bgcolor=#33ccff>
<img border="0" src="caliseo.jpg">
<h1> <div align="center">Votre nouvel appel a ete enregistrer</div></h1>
<?
$bdd = "hotline";
$user = "root";
$passwd = "";
$host = "localhost";
mysql_connect($host, $user,$passwd) or die("erreur de connexion au serveur");
mysql_select_db($bdd) or die("erreur de connexion a la base de donnees");
$nom_diplomat=$_POST['nom_diplomat'];
$nom_contact=$_POST['nom_contact'];
$date=$_POST['date'];
$duree=$_POST['duree'];
$probleme=$_POST['probleme'];
$resolution=$_POST['resolution'];
$societe=$_POST['societe'];
/* $requette="INSERT INTO appels ( nom_diplomat , nom_contact , date , duree , probleme , resolution , societe )
VALUES ($nom_diplomat , $nom_contact , $date , $duree , $duree , $probleme , $resolution )";
$requettenouvelappel=mysql_query($requette);
echo($requette);*/
echo($nom_diplomat);
echo($nom_contact);
echo($date);
echo($duree);
echo($probleme);
echo($resolution);
?>
</body>
</html>
l'informatique ca rend fou!!!!!
                        
                    aidez moi plz, je suis trop dans la misere la!!
je trime depuis le retour de midi, et je vais me faire allumer :(
help me!!!!
l'informatique ca rend fou!!!!!
    
                je trime depuis le retour de midi, et je vais me faire allumer :(
help me!!!!
l'informatique ca rend fou!!!!!
                        
                    Bonjour!
Le problème est résolu ou non ? Alors en fait il ne t'affiche que ton premier echo c'est ca ? Et les autres il met juste rien ou il y a des messages d'erreur ?
Flipody
    
                Le problème est résolu ou non ? Alors en fait il ne t'affiche que ton premier echo c'est ca ? Et les autres il met juste rien ou il y a des messages d'erreur ?
Flipody
    je te remercie fipody de t interresser ;)
c est bon, ai chercher hier soir et en fait, le probeme (en dehors des balises et autre erreur du gere que l'on ma signalé ici) il c'est avéré que cela venait de easy php!!
en fait j ai du tout le reinstaler et depuis ca marche nikel!!!!;)
l'informatique ca rend fou!!!!!
    c est bon, ai chercher hier soir et en fait, le probeme (en dehors des balises et autre erreur du gere que l'on ma signalé ici) il c'est avéré que cela venait de easy php!!
en fait j ai du tout le reinstaler et depuis ca marche nikel!!!!;)
l'informatique ca rend fou!!!!!
